Role Overview

Crown House Technologies - Enterprise Solutions are part of the Laing O'Rourke construction group. Enterprise Solutions provide the expertise to deliver the specialist systems, Building Energy Management Systems (BEMS), Security Systems (CCTV, Access Control, Intruder Alarms), Information Communications Technology (ICT) and Lighting Control (LCS) associated with mechanical, electrical and public health (MEP) installations.

You will work within the BEMS team under the guidance of our experienced Engineers, alongside site supervisors and managers.

You must have strong technical acumen with a positive interest in engineering & technology. You will also have a professional approach and a keen eye for detail; excellent communication and IT skills are also vital for the role.

Key Deliverables and Accountabilities of a BEMS Controls Apprentice To learn and understand automated control systems To be able to read a specification and apply control principles associated with the design to create engineering documentation Understand communications technology and standard industry protocols Understanding the requirements for the installation of electrical wiring systems To learn, understand and manage the production automated application software, system graphical user interface (GUI) and Digital engineering (DE) Assist the commissioning and point to point testing and commission control panels (CP) to monitor and control mechanical systems Adhere to all company policies & procedures, particularly to health & safety

Location Oxford, North West and South

Apprenticeship Level and Standard BEMS (building energy management systems) controls engineer - Level 4

Apprenticeship Provider National training provider Group Horizon Ltd, in partnership with the Building Controls Industry Association (BCIA)

Entry Grades 5 GCSEs - preferably grades 7-4 in Maths and English 3 A-levels or BTEC

Entry requirements You must be eligible to work in the UK with a valid work permit Entry grades will be listed within each job description, and they will differ from role to role To qualify for this programme, you will need to have a minimum of three A-Levels/or equivalent

The Laing O'Rourke Professional Apprenticeship Programme - what can you expect?

Our professional apprenticeship programme has been developed to ensure you are supported throughout every step of your journey, combining work-based experience with off-the-job training. You will be stretched, challenged and supported by a business that views your professional development and formal qualification as a priority.

Our programme will provide a fully funded day or block release Level 4 (HNC) and/or Level 6 (degree) apprenticeship in your chosen vocation, while working as a full time Laing O'Rourke employee. It will also include a series of bespoke development modules, and technical training opportunities, strategically placed to support you at key stages of your apprenticeship journey. During the programme you will work across a range of projects, which will offer the breadth and variety to support your occupational competency and will contribute towards the achievement of your apprenticeship and professional accreditation.

** The Professional Apprenticeship Programme will commence in September 2025 **
